Targeting and Segmentation in PPC Campaigns
Targeting and Segmentation in PPC Campaigns
PPC (Pay-Per-Click) campaigns are an effective way to drive targeted traffic to your website and increase conversions. However, in order to achieve optimal results, it is crucial to properly target and segment your PPC campaigns. By doing so, you can ensure that your ads reach the right audience at the right time, maximizing your ROI and overall campaign performance.
Understanding Targeting in PPC Campaigns
In PPC advertising, targeting refers to selecting the specific audience you want your ads to appear in front of. When running a PPC campaign, you have various targeting options available to you, such as:
- Geographic Targeting: Allows you to reach users in specific geographic locations. This can be useful for businesses that operate locally or have a specific target market in mind.
- Demographic Targeting: Enables you to target users based on demographic information such as age, gender, income, education, and more. This type of targeting can be particularly useful for businesses that have a clear understanding of their ideal customer profile.
- Device Targeting: Lets you choose which devices your ads will appear on, such as desktops, mobile phones, or tablets. Considering the increasing mobile usage, it is essential to optimize your ads for mobile devices.
- Interest Targeting: Allows you to target users based on their interests, behaviors, or previous online activities. This targeting method relies on user data collected by search engines and other platforms to determine users' preferences and display relevant ads.
The Importance of Segmentation in PPC Campaigns
Segmenting your PPC campaigns involves dividing your target audience into smaller, more specific groups, enabling you to create highly targeted ads and improve campaign performance. Here are a few key reasons why segmentation is crucial:
- Relevance: By segmenting your audience, you can tailor your ad messaging to match each segment's specific needs and interests. This increases the relevance of your ads, making users more likely to click on them and convert.
- Control: Segmenting your campaigns allows you to have better control over your budget and bidding strategy. You can allocate different budgets to different segments, prioritize high-performing segments, and adjust bids accordingly.
- Testing: Segmentation enables you to conduct A/B testing more effectively. By testing different variations of your ads across different segments, you can gather valuable insights about what resonates best with each audience segment and refine your campaigns accordingly.
- Optimization: With segmentation, you can track and analyze the performance of each segment individually. This helps you identify areas for improvement and optimization, allowing you to refine your targeting, messaging, and bidding strategy for maximum efficiency.
Best Practices for Targeting and Segmentation
To make the most out of your PPC campaigns, here are a few best practices to follow when it comes to targeting and segmentation:
- Research Your Audience: Before launching your PPC campaigns, invest time in understanding your target audience. Conduct market research, analyze competitor strategies, and gather as much data as possible about your ideal customers.
- Combine Targeting Methods: Rather than relying solely on one targeting method, consider combining multiple methods to refine your audience selection. For example, you can narrow down your geographic targeting by adding demographic and interest targeting layers.
- Create Specific Landing Pages: For each audience segment, consider creating dedicated landing pages that align with their specific interests and needs. Sending users to relevant landing pages improves their experience, boosts conversions, and positively impacts your Quality Score.
- Regularly Monitor and Optimize: Keep a close eye on the performance of your PPC campaigns. Regularly analyze data, identify areas for improvement, and make the necessary adjustments to enhance your targeting, messaging, and overall campaign performance.
By implementing effective targeting and segmentation strategies in your PPC campaigns, you can ensure that your ads are seen by the right people, at the right time, and in the right context. This not only improves campaign performance but also enhances the overall user experience, ultimately driving higher conversions and business growth.
